Damaged Seals

Window seals help keep windows safe from cold air, moisture, and draughts. They provide a front line defence against energy waste, which can lead to rising costs for utilities and discomfort for your family or business's customers. Window seals, however, do not have a definite life span and should be inspected regularly for wear and tear, and eventually replacement.

The windows that are cloudy indicate that the window seals in your home have failed. A window seal is the space between two panes of glass in an IGU (insulated glazing unit). It contains a polyurethane or similar gas that gives additional insulation and keeps moisture out. If moisture gets in the crack, it could cause condensation and cause windows to appear blurred on both sides.

A double-glazed window is made by putting two panes of glass and an opening bar between them, forming a gap that's filled with gas or air for added insulation. The space between the two panes of glass is filled with air or gas to provide insulation. However, with time it can become permeable because of wear and environmental factors. This causes moisture to collect within the window's cavity, making the windows appear blurred.

This is usually caused by a damaged seal within the sealed unit. This allows humid air to enter the space between the panes. When this occurs, the moisture causes condensation, which results in the appearance of a fog, which is unattractive and inefficient. This can lead to a loss in the insulating properties of the window, resulting in higher heating costs.
